The Westhill Warriors will venture away from home to square off against the Liverpool Warriors at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. The teams are on pretty different trajectories at the moment (Westhill has four straight victories, Liverpool has three straight losses), but none of that matters once you're on the court.
On Tuesday, Westhill made easy work of Marcellus and carried off a 3-0 win.
Westhill walked away with the victory (and looked especially good in the first set). The final score came out to 25-14, 25-21, 25-16.
Meanwhile, Liverpool came up short against Shenendehowa on Saturday and fell 2-0.
The match finished with set scores of 25-10, 25-13.
Westhill has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won 11 of their last 13 contests, which provided a nice bump to their 23-4-3 record this season. As for Liverpool, their defeat dropped their record down to 7-7-1.
Westhill skirted past Liverpool 2-1 in their previous matchup back in September. Does Westhill have another victory up their sleeve, or will Liverpool tur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
